摘 要:目的观察糖克煎剂对早期糖尿病大鼠TGF-β1/Smad4表达的影响,探讨糖克煎剂防治早期糖尿病肾保护作用的效果及机制。方法 SD大鼠随机分为正常对照组(12只)、模型组(10只)、中药预防组(10只)、中药治疗组(10只)、西药对照组(10只)。中药预防组造模成功后立即给予灌服糖克煎剂(18g/kg);其余各组均在造模成功4周后灌胃给药。模型组和正常对照组予等量生理盐水,西药对照组予灌服贝那普利混悬液(1mg/kg),中药治疗组给予灌服糖克煎剂(18g/kg)。中药预防组共给药12周,中药治疗组及西药对照组给药8周,均每日1次。实验结束检测各组大鼠体重、肾重、肾重指数、空腹血糖和24h尿微量白蛋白排泄率;HE染色、Masson染色及电镜观察各组大鼠肾组织病理形态学变化;采用免疫组化法检测肾组织转化生长因子(TGF-β1)及其内部传导分子Smad4的表达。结果与正常对照组比较,模型组大鼠体重明显降低,肾重、肾重指数、血糖、24h尿蛋白定量、尿蛋白排泄率、肾脏TGF-β1和Smad4的表达均明显增加,差异均有统计学意义(P<0.01);各用药组上述指标与模型组比较均有所改善,差异均有统计学意义(P<0.05,P<0.01);与西药对照组比较,中药预防组肾重、肾重指数、血糖、24h尿蛋白定量及尿蛋白排泄率明显改善,差异有统计学意义(P<0.01)。肾脏病理变化以模型组最为明显,各用药组均有不同程度改善。结论糖克煎剂可明显改善糖尿病症状,并且下调早期糖尿病大鼠肾脏TGF-β1和Smad4的表达。说明糖克煎剂对早期糖尿病肾病有一定的防治作用。Objective To observe the effect of Tangke Decoction (TD) on the expression of TGF- β1/Smad4 of rats with early diabetes and to explore the effect and mechanism of TD against the renal injury induced by diabetes. Methods SD rats were randomly divided into the normal control group (n =12), the model group (n =10), the Chinese herbs prevented group (n =10), the Chinese herbs treated group (n = 10), and the Western medicine control group (n =10). TD (18 mg/kg) was given by gastrogavage to rats in the Chinese herbs prevented group immediately after successful modeling for 12 weeks, once daily. At the 4th week of successful modeling, rats in the rest 4 groups were administered by gastrogavage. Equal volume of normal saline was given to rats in the model group and the normal control group. Benazepril suspension (1 mg/kg) was administered by gastrogavage to rats in the Western medicine control group for 8 weeks, once daily. TD (18 mg/kg) was given by gastrogavage to rats in the Chinese herbs treated group for 8 weeks, once daily. The body weight,kidney weight,index of kidney weight, fasting blood sugar, 24 h u- rinary albumin excretion rate were examined after experiment. The pathological changes of the renal tissue were observed by HE staining, Masson staining, and electron microscope. The expression of renal trans- forming growth factor-β1 (TGF-β1) and Smad4 were detected using immunohistochemical assay. Results Compared with the normal control group, the body weight of rats decreased significantly; the kidney weight, index of kidney weight, blood sugar, 24 h urinary protein excretion, the urinary albumin excretion rate ,TGF-β1 and Smad4 expression increased significantly in the model group (all P 〈0.01 ). Compared with the model group, the aforesaid indices were improved in each treatment group with statistical difference (P 〈0.05, P 〈0.01 ).
